用于存储数据
存放数据的一个容器
例如你每天使用余额宝查看自己的账户收益,就是从数据库读取数据后给你的。
表(数据库对象)存储数据
表:相关的数据项的集合,由列和行组成
表:包含带有数据的记录(行)
一个数据库通常包含一个或多个表
操纵数据库的语言
用于访问和处理数据库的标准的计算机语言
结构化查询语言
一种 ==ANSI ==的标准计算机语言
SQL 可与数据库程序协同工作
比如 MS Access、DB2、Informix、MS SQL Server、Oracle、Sybase 以及其他数据库系统。
由于各种各样的数据库出现,导致很多不同版本的 SQL 语言,为了与 ANSI 标准相兼容,它们必须以相似的方式共同地来支持一些主要的关键词( SELECT、UPDATE、DELETE、INSERT、WHERE 等等),这些就是我们要学习的SQL基础。
有表才能查询
CREATE TABLE 表名称
(
列名称1 数据类型,
列名称2 数据类型,
列名称3 数据类型,
....
);
create table smytest
(
column1 text,
column2 varchar(255)
);
数据类型(data_type)规定了列可容纳何种数据类型